Studies on the Synthesis of C-Nucleosides--Synthesis of 3-β-D-XyIopyranosyl-1,2,4-Oxadiazoles

Abstract: Fourteen new derivatives of 3-β-D-xylopyranosyl 1,2,4-oxadiazole were synthesized via condensating protected β-D-xylopyranosyl amidoxime with anhydrides or various substituted benzoyl chlorides in good yields.The 1,2,4-oxadiazole ring was formed directly by condensation of xylopyranosyl amidoxime and various anhydrides, but if the condensation occured by using substituted benzoyl chloride instead of anhydride, the cyclization was completed by two steps.The mechanism was discussed, 3-β-.D-xylopyranosyl-1,2,4-oxadiazole is stable under the condition of 1 mol/L HCl, 1 mol/L NaOH or at high temperature.

Key words: 1,2,4-Oxadiazole, Xylosyi C-nucleoside, Condensation reaction
